  6. Biografie. Anzeige. Nancy Sandra Sinatra (* 8. Juni 1940 in Jersey City, New Jersey) ist eine US-amerikanische Sängerin und Schauspielerin. Ihre größten Erfolge hatte sie in den 1960er Jahren mit Songs wie These Boots Are Made for Walkin’ sowie den Duetten Summer Wine mit Lee Hazlewood und Somethin’ Stupid mit ihrem Vater Frank Sinatra.
